When you are in business school, you will be required to write several different essays. One of these is the business essay. Business essays allow you to demonstrate your understanding of business concepts and theories. It also allows you to show your ability to think critically about business issues and problems. There are a few things that you can do to make sure that your business essay is successful. First, make sure that you understand the question. Take the time to read it carefully and make sure that you know. Next, develop a strong thesis statement. Your thesis statement should state your position on the issue of discussion.

What does business mean?
Business generally refers to organizations that seek profits by providing goods or services in exchange for payment. However, businesses don't need to turn a profit to be considered a business. The pursuit of profit, in and of itself, makes an organization a business.
